The "Almaty Notes" series is intended to maintain focus on developments in civil society, the media, and the opposition in Kazakhstan's "southern capital" following the move of the Embassy to Astana. President Meets with Moderate Opposition Leaders -------------- --- ¶2. On April 23 in Almaty, President Nazarbayev met with opposition leaders Alikhan Baymenov and Zharmakhan Tuyakbay. At the meeting with Baymenov they discussed urgent problems of political development of the country, humanitarian and cultural issues including the development of Kazakh language, and patriotic upbringing of the young generation. At the meeting with Tuyakbay they discussed constitutional reforms. According to a National Social-Democratic Party press release, Tuyakbay called the president's attention to violations of the law during the recent formation of Almaty City election commissions. Tuyakbay also reportedly stressed the necessity of a dialogue between the authorities and opposition parties and public organizations. On April 19, the mothers and wives of eight "Shanyrak Defenders" kept in detention attempted to picket the Almaty City Court building. The women demanded that their husbands and sons be released and the criminal cases against them be dismissed. The police disrupted the action. Two participants were detained. The May 3 hearing of Bulat Abilov's case at the Almalinskiy district court in Almaty was disrupted because the 'victims' in the case failed to appear in the court. At a meeting with prominent businessmen in Almaty on April 21, President Nazarbayev recommended ending intensive construction in Almaty because the city infrastructure cannot support such development and it is hazardous for the environment. (Vremya daily, April 24) ¶6. On April 24, Prime Minister Masimov directed Almaty Oblast and City akims to terminate land sales in the region until there is a special order. "It is not a secret that some companies purchase lands at the cadastre [tax assessment] cost and then sell it at market cost," Masimov said. Due to this, Masimov ordered that "all commercial lands in Almaty City and Almaty Oblast should be passed to the 'Zhetysu' special corporation. The money this corporation will earn should used to develop utility services and infrastructure." (www.gazeta.kz, April 24) ¶7. The Almaty City administration plans to demolish a unique seismic station located in the mountains close to the city. In place of the station the administration intends to build a net of cafes and restaurants. (www.geo.kz, April 24) NGO Calls on President to Dismiss Almaty City Akim -------------- -------------- ¶8. Activists of the "Let Us Defend our City" committee held a press conference on April 24 in Almaty to brief journalists about the city administration's refusal to grant them a permit to hold a rally in the center of the city. According to the activists, Almaty City Akim Tasmagambetov has ignored the president's and prime minister's orders to put an end to construction in Almaty. "By doing this, Tasmagambetov creates a dangerous situation in the southern capital," the committee's statement reads. The statement calls on the president to dismiss Akim Tasmagambetov. The Central Election Commission has opened the first training center in Almaty for e-voting machine operators. As part of preparations to September elections to Maslikhats, more than half of the city precinct election commissions are slated to be equipped with e-voting machines. On April 23 the city court of Almaty rejected a motion filed by the Bostandyk district procurator who asked the court to arrest Aynur Kurmanov for organizing unsanctioned picketing of the "Almatyzher" office on March 30. Kurmanov had been fined for this action, but the procurator found this punishment too light. (www.incar.info, April 23) MILAS
